What happens

Ambush is a 1988 Filipino action film directed by Francis "Jun" Posadas and written by Jerry O. Tirazona. Starring Ronnie Ricketts, Dick Israel, Sonny Parsons, E.R. Ejercito, Leo Lazaro, Bobby Zshornack, and Beverly Vergel, the story follows an armed struggle between the New People's Army's Sparrow Unit and the Armed Forces of the Philippines. Produced by Regent Films, the film was theatrically released on July 13, 1988.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
